Canvas Information Night for Families:
Canvas is our district-wide learning management system used in grades E-12. It’s the main platform for all secondary courses.
Families, did you know you can access Canvas to stay up-to-date on your student’s learning and progress? Join our district Technology Integration Specialists for an informational session to learn more about how Canvas works, including:
Setting Up Your Parent/Caregiver Account: Get support setting up your Canvas Parent account and pairing it with your scholar’s account.
Viewing Assignments and Grades: Stay updated about what your scholar is working on and how they are performing.
Communicating with Teachers: Easily reach out to educators for any questions or concerns.
Accessing Learning Resources: Find helpful materials to support your scholar’s learning journey.
Q & A: Get all your Canvas-related questions answered.

Hopkins Education Foundation News
Tickets are now on sale for our big fundraising gala on Saturday, March 1, 2025, at the Metropolitan Ballroom in Golden Valley. The Royal Bash will celebrate the 30th anniversary of the Hopkins Education Foundation and feature a seated dinner, presentation, entertainment, games, live music from Watson, and more. We will raise funds for our annual special project and Spark Grants for Hopkins teachers. This year, our Outdoor Opportunities special project will help Hopkins students develop outdoor and leadership skills, build community, and experience joy and connection to the natural world with activities like camping, hiking, canoeing, and more. When you join us at the Royal Bash, you'll have a chance to learn about HEF’s 30-year history of helping Hopkins schools and help us acknowledge this milestone! We hope you will join us.
